As a workaround for mac users, the following steps activate listening to
cups broadcasts (thus allowing automatic detection of linux shared
printers again):

On your mac use a web browser to open:
http://localhost:631/admin/?ADVANCEDSETTINGS=YES

on the right hand side under "server settings" make sure that "Show
printers shared by other systems" and "Protocols: CUPS" are checked.

click "save settings"

enter the username and password of an admin account (e.g. your login).

done
